Leading forensic psychiatrist Dr Gwen Adshead reflects on her work with survivors of trauma. Three survivors of a helicopter crash have very different responses to the incident.

Pioneering forensic psychiatrist and psychotherapist, Dr Gwen Adshead, has spent thirty years as a therapist in secure hospitals, prisons and in the community.

In UNSPEAKABLE we witness her work with patients in the aftermath of distressing and traumatic events and see how speech, language and silence can influence recovery after catastrophe.

Dr Adshead was the BBC Reith Lecturer in 2024.

PART THREE - THE LUCKY ONES - part 2
Three survivors of a helicopter crash have very different responses to the incident and in how they have coped in the aftermath.
